Your new role
As our new Senior Mechanical Design Engineer, you will be part of our growing UK team working on healthcare projects throughout the UK and internationally. You will have the opportunity to thrive in technical delivery excellence and develop an excellent understanding of client care.
Your key responsibilities will be:
- Lead, develop and manage a team of Mechanical Engineers, working collaboratively with colleagues from other engineering disciplines.
- Positively raise the profile and reputation of Ramboll and our UK Healthcare Team.
- Develop and oversee mechanical concepts and design solutions.
- Undertake detailed design to required standards, and complete design calculations using industry software.
- Inspire and enthuse the engineers and technicians working with you on your projects.
- Liaise with clients and collaborators, representing Ramboll at project meetings.
- Support key accounts and develop relationships with new clients.
- Support our UK Healthcare team sector business development strategies.
- Implement best practice procedures to enhance and maintain delivery of sustainable, zero carbon, innovative and quality advisory and design services.
- Manage your own projects and act as MEP or mechanical engineering project manager to allocate resources and co-ordinate tasks.

Ramboll in the United Kingdom
Founded in Denmark, Ramboll is a foundation-owned company with a proven track record of sustainable and responsible business. We are a top ten engineering, environmental, and sustainability consultancy in the UK, with over 1,500 employees across 16 offices dedicated to building a more sustainable future. Our experts deliver innovative solutions across Buildings, Transport, Environment & Health, Energy, and more.
